- I'm looking for the best tape backup I can get for under $500. I've
- seen adds for a $250-ish 250Mb Colorado tape backup, but what I'm most
- concerned with is portability and reliability (vs capacity). I've
- only got a 210Mb drive to worry about (right now).
-
- A friend tells me that QIC-24 format will be readable just about
- anywhere. What are the most common tape formats, and who supports
- them?
